Web1 dec. 2024 · Medicare Part A covers only 190 days for inpatient care in a psychiatric hospital over your entire lifetime. Any days you spend in a general hospital do not count toward the 190-day lifetime limit — even if you were admitted for mental health reasons or are receiving treatment for a mental health condition. Web19 nov. 2024 · Inpatient psychiatric care provided in a free-standing psychiatric hospital has a lifetime limitation of 190 days. The following is an overview of what is and is not …

Web9 dec. 2024 · Medicare Part B covers mental health services you get as an outpatient, such as through a clinic or therapist’s office. Medicare covers counseling services, including diagnostic assessments including, but not necessarily limited to: Psychiatric evaluation and diagnostic tests. Individual therapy.
